Zc:WD design diary 1

https://cmon.com/news/zombicide-white-death-design-diary-1-welcome-to-wintergrad

White Death introduces intelligent humanoid-animal-hybrid species. Meet Lorna from the mystical canine people called Kenshan, and Ogon, one of the Khanra, the cat people. They don’t have any sort of special rules players have to remember. They are just cool.



In Zombicide: White Death, Survivors cannot flee anymore, as the city is surrounded by Zombies. They have to resist, which is a different take on the Zombicide theme. The new setting introduces a snow-covered urban area with medieval ramparts with corresponding special rules!

Huge walls separate the board in several areas, preventing free passage for the survivors... and the Zombies. These ramparts can be climbed upon, using either stairs or rope ladders. Players can move and fight on Battlement Walkways on top of ramparts.

Zombies, mindless as they are, cannot use rope ladders. To get on top, they have to use stairs . Occasionally however, a special “Zombie Siege!” card allows Zombies to climb and cross Ramparts in a fit of rage! Also, undead as they are, Zombies standing on top of Battlement Walkways can harmlessly fall to pursue their prey.

But the Survivors also get some new tricks. They can find Cauldrons to place on Battlement Walkways and throw hot tar at Zombies below, eliminating everyone there.

And finally (for now), being in a winter-themed environment comes with perks . The new Freeze mechanic allows Survivors to temporarily immobilize Zombies.
